Best Trails

Wisconsin’s top ski-in/ski-out destinations boast some of the most epic trails in the Midwest, with Devil’s Head’s 30 groomed trails and Granite Peak’s 74 runs offering something for every skill level.

You’ll find gentle slopes for beginners and challenging black diamond runs for experts. As you explore these trails, you’ll take in bre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ape.

With so many options, you can choose a new trail every day, and still have plenty to discover. You’ll love the variety and excitement that Wisconsin’s ski-in/ski-out destinations have to offer, making your winter vacation unforgettable.

Local Spots

The Midwest’s premier ski-in/ski-out destinations are found in Wisconsin, where elite resorts like Devil’s Head and Granite Peak offer unparalleled access to the slopes.

You’ll discover world-class skiing and snowboarding at these exceptional resorts. As you explore Wisconsin’s local spots, you’ll find that Devil’s Head offers 30 trails and Granite Peak features 74 trails.

Both resorts provide a unique skiing experience, with Devil’s Head catering to families and Granite Peak suiting thrill-seekers. You can enjoy the scenic views, varied terrain, and convenient amenities that make Wisconsin’s ski-in/ski-out rentals a winter dream come true.

Snow Trails

Snow Trails in Wisconsin offer a unique skiing experience, with over 700 miles of cross-country skiing trails that’ll take you through scenic forests, rolling hills, and frozen lakes.

You’ll glide through snow-covered landscapes, enjoying the peaceful atmosphere and breathtaking views. As you ski, you’ll discover diverse wildlife and vegetation, making each trail a new adventure.

With varying difficulty levels, you can choose trails that suit your skills, from easy to challenging. You’ll experience the beauty of Wisconsin’s winter landscape, creating unforgettable memories.

The trails are well-groomed, ensuring a smooth ride.
